Given Input numbers are 197, 675, 111, 853
To find the GCD of numbers using factoring list out all the divisors of each number
Divisors of 197
List of positive integer divisors of 197 that divides 197 without a remainder.
1, 197
Divisors of 675
List of positive integer divisors of 675 that divides 675 without a remainder.
1, 3, 5, 9, 15, 25, 27, 45, 75, 135, 225, 675
Divisors of 111
List of positive integer divisors of 111 that divides 111 without a remainder.
1, 3, 37, 111
Divisors of 853
List of positive integer divisors of 853 that divides 853 without a remainder.
1, 853
Greatest Common Divisior
We found the divisors of 197, 675, 111, 853 . The biggest common divisior number is the GCD number.
So the Greatest Common Divisior 197, 675, 111, 853 is 1.
Therefore, GCD of numbers 197, 675, 111, 853 is 1
Given Input Data is 197, 675, 111, 853
Make a list of Prime Factors of all the given numbers initially
Prime Factorization of 197 is 197
Prime Factorization of 675 is 3 x 3 x 3 x 5 x 5
Prime Factorization of 111 is 3 x 37
Prime Factorization of 853 is 853
The above numbers do not have any common prime factor. So GCD is 1
